« Reply #26 on: April 12, 2010, 10:45:51 AM »

Agreed, you should get a mount as fast you can.

Currently, scaling is very linear, I *have* to calculate with mounts.

Mounts usually buff yourself, hence the big impact.

If you're level 1, you should have some leftover money from your first kill - use that to by a good weapon and some armour, and it will be much easier.

Torments are - by the way - not based on mounts at all. And you can be defeated there easily in the first levels.
